以INV
开头但没有INV
前缀的发票编号。
我的任务是不在报告文件中显示INV
前缀。 SSRS中的当前表达式为=First(Fields!InvoiceNumber.Value, "InvoiceDataSet")
。
我想知道是否存在我可以在SSRS中添加的条件或更改表达式以隐藏或不显示INV
,但是显示该数字的其余部分即删除字符串?
尝试执行=Left(Fields!InvoiceNumber.Value, len(Fields!InvoiceNumber.Value)-3) "InvoiceDataSet")
答案 0 :(得分:1)
你几乎就在那里。将LEFT
更改为RIGHT
。
=Right(First(Fields!InvoiceNumber.Value, "InvoiceDataSet"), Len(First(Fields!InvoiceNumber.Value, "InvoiceDataSet"))-3)